.In a Democratic system of government, Its the police,that is empowered by law,to be solely in charge of internal security, the military is only called in,in a very serious security emergency. However, in our own case,the military has virtually taking over the functions of the police and this not a good development in our nascent democracy. This recent order by Mr.president, is a good development, but i believe that it will be best,if the withdrawal of our military personnel is done gradually because of the current ill equipped State of our police force. If our police is well funded,and equipped, there will not be any internal security challenge that won't be able to handle.I was surprised during the unfortunate Boston bombing in the US that it was the police handled the situation, in contrast to ours here where the military will be immediately deployed.
